Metro Police are asking for the public’s help in locating a 55-year-old man who they say went missing Tuesday.

Dexter Clary was last seen on foot in the area of Charleston Boulevard and Rancho Drive around 2 p.m., police said.

Clary stands 6-feet-1 and weighs 190 pounds, police said. He was seen wearing a black, long-sleeve shirt and navy blue jogging pants with a white stripe down the sides.

Police say Clary might be emotionally distressed, disoriented, confused and lost.
